Program Overview: B.S. in Computer Science at Manhattan University

The Bachelor of Science in Computer Science at Manhattan University teaches you how to analyze problems, design algorithmic solutions, and implement them using industry-standard programming languages such as C++ and Java. Located on a 23-acre campus in the Riverdale neighborhood of the Bronx, just 35 minutes from midtown Manhattan by subway, you benefit from proximity to one of the largest technology job markets in the United States.

The program is housed within the Kakos School of Science and combines rigorous computer science theory with hands-on software design projects and an engaging senior capstone experience. You will study under expert faculty who are widely published and active in professional associations such as the Association of Computing Machinery (ACM) and the Institute of Electrical and Electronics Engineers (IEEE).

Manhattan University also offers specialized concentrations in Artificial Intelligence and Machine Learning as well as Cybersecurity within the B.S. degree, allowing you to tailor your studies to emerging industry demands. Graduates are well prepared for careers in technology or for advanced study, with a special one-year pathway available to continue directly into the M.S. in Computer Science program.

Curriculum and Course Modules

The B.S. in Computer Science curriculum balances foundational computer science theory with practical programming skills and a strong liberal arts core. You will progress from introductory programming through advanced topics in algorithms, systems, and applied computing, culminating in a senior capstone design project.

Computer Science I (CMPT 101)

3 Credits

An introduction to basic programming concepts and problem-solving skills using the C++ language. Topics include flow of control, loops, functions, arrays, strings, and files.

Computer Science II (CMPT 102)

3 Credits

An introduction to advanced programming concepts using C++. Topics include pointers, structured data, classes, inheritance, polymorphism, exceptions, templates, and recursion.

Data Structures (CMPT 238/239)

3 Credits

Study of fundamental data structures and algorithms used in software development. Students strengthen problem-solving techniques and deepen their understanding of efficient data organization.

Design and Analysis of Algorithms

3 Credits

A rigorous study of algorithm design paradigms and complexity analysis. Students learn to evaluate algorithmic efficiency and apply techniques to solve computational problems.

Operating Systems

3 Credits

Covers the principles of modern operating systems including process management, memory management, file systems, and concurrency. Students gain practical experience with system-level programming.

Software Engineering (CMPT 456)

3 Credits

A study of the principles and methods for developing large and complex software systems. Each student participates in a team project devoted to the specification, design, and implementation of a sizable software system.

Admission Requirements

Manhattan University welcomes applications from students worldwide. The university operates on a rolling admissions basis, and all applications and inquiries are handled through Uni4Edu to ensure a seamless process for international applicants.

Academic Requirements

  • High School GPAMinimum 2.5 cumulative GPA from college preparatory studies (average admitted GPA is approximately 3.4 on a 4.0 scale)
  • Secondary School TranscriptOfficial high school transcript indicating courses completed and grades, evaluated and translated by a NACES-approved agency when applicable
  • Standardized TestsTest-optional policy; SAT or ACT scores are not required but may be submitted
  • Letter of RecommendationAt least one letter from a teacher or guidance counselor; up to three academic letters may be submitted
  • Personal StatementA brief personal essay of approximately 500 words reflecting your interests and goals

English Language Requirements

  • TOEFL iBTMinimum score of 80
  • IELTSMinimum overall band score of 6.5
  • Duolingo English TestMinimum score of 105

Required Documents

Official secondary school transcript (evaluated by a NACES-approved agency for international credentials) Personal statement or college essay (approximately 500 words) At least one letter of recommendation Proof of English proficiency (TOEFL, IELTS, or Duolingo) Copy of passport and financial documentation for visa purposes

Key Application Deadlines

November 15 Early Decision Deadline
February 15 Scholarship Consideration Deadline
March 1 Priority Rolling Admission Deadline
